Supporting Windows Vista provides an in-depth look at Microsoft's latest desktop and laptop operating system, Windows Vista. Topics covered include: installing Windows Vista, hardware and applications, setting up user accounts, customizing the desktop, configuring security options, monitoring performance, and troubleshooting startup problems. Written to help you easily integrate the new operating system and designed to accompany A+ Guide to Managing and Maintaining Your PC, Sixth Edition, and A+ Guide to Software, Fourth Edition, you will learn how to successfully install, maintain, secure and troubleshoot this new OS.
